Memory Ring

Shape memory alloy thermal shrink rings (referred to as: memory rings) are made using the memory recovery characteristics of shape memory alloys. Parts are simply placed and heated above a specified temperature for self-installation of the relevant fasteners. Features: 1. Assembled products can be used stably in environments ranging from -50℃ to 250℃. 2. Easy installation and operation; fastening is achieved simply by heating to a specified temperature, providing stable fastening force. 3. Weld-free, corrosion-resistant, vibration-resistant, impact-resistant, and fatigue-resistant with a long lifespan.

  • Memory Ring Selection

    Users generally follow these steps when selecting memory rings:

    1. Select the cable based on the signal line's capacity and number of cores;
    2. Select the electrical connector based on the number of cable core wires;

    3. Select the connector's end fitting based on the connector model and cable size;

    4. Select the corresponding memory ring model based on the end fitting's outlet size;

    5. When selecting a US standard memory ring, select series A or B based on the thickness of the wave protection cover;

    6. Select whether to include an insulation layer based on the user's assembly heating method or usage habits. Add a suffix if an insulation layer is included;

    1; No suffix is added if there is no insulation layer. Example:
    TR-04 is a domestic standard series memory ring, TR-04, without an insulation layer;
    TR-041 is a domestic standard series memory ring, TR-04, with an insulation layer;
    TR-04A is a US standard series A memory ring, TR-04A, without an insulation layer;
    TR-04AI is a US standard series A memory ring, TR-04A, with an insulation layer;

    TR-04B is a US standard series B memory ring, TR-04B, without an insulation layer; TR04BI is a US standard series B memory ring, TR-04B, with an insulation layer;

     

     

     

     

     

     

    Step Explanation

     

    Standard Size D1: Represents the inner diameter before the memory ring shrinks; D: Represents the outer diameter of the connector's end fitting; D2: Represents the inner diameter after the memory ring shrinks under no-load heating; : Represents the inner surface with an insulation coating

     

    Table 1 Domestic Standard Series Memory Ring Model Size Table

    Model D 1 +01.5 (mm) D(mm) D 2 +01.5 (mm)
    TR-04(l) 10.40 9.5 9.8
    TR-05(l) 11.95 11.0 11.2
    TR-06(l) 13.70 12.7 12.9
    TR-07(l) 15.30 14.3 14.4
    TR-08(l) 17.00 15.9 16.0
    TR-10() 20.20 19.0 19.0
    TR-12(I) 23.45 22.2 22.0
    TR-14(I) 26.85 25.4 25.2
    TR-16(I) 30.15 28.5 28.3
    TR-18(I) 33.55 31.8 31.5
    TR-2O(I) 36.80 35.0 34.6
    TR-22(I) 39.95 38.0 37.6
    TR-24(I) 43.50 41.3 40.9

     

    Table 2 US Standard Series A Memory Ring Model Size Table

    Model D 1 +0.12 (mm) D(mm)MAX D 2 (mm)
    TR-04A (I) 10.08 9.5 9.73
    TR-05A (I) 11.68 11.1 11.28
    TR-06A (I) 13.28 12.7 12.83
    TR-07A (I) 14.91 14.3 14.38
    TR-08A (I) 16.51 15.9 15.90
    TR-1OA (I) 19.74 19.0 19.00
    TR-12A (I) 22.99 22.2 22.15
    TR-14A (I) 26.26 25.4 25.27
    TR-16A (I) 29.52 28.6 28.42
    TR-18A (I) 32.82 31.8 31.55
    TR-20A (I) 36.09 34.9 34.70
    TR-22A (I) 39.33 38.1 37.08
    TR-24A (I) 42.58 41.3 40.14

     

    Table 3 US Standard Series B Memory Ring Model Size Table

    Model D 1 +0.12 (mm) D(mm)MAX D 2 (mm)
    TR-04B (I) 10.59 9.5 10.22
    TR-05B (I) 12.19 11.1 11.74
    TR-06B (I) 13.82 12.7 13.28
    TR-07B (I) 15.42 14.3 14.83
    TR-08B (I) 17.02 15.9 16.38
    TR-10B (I) 20.24 19.0 19.48
    TR-12B (I) 23.55 22.2 22.61
    TR-14B (I) 26.77 25.4 25.73
    TR-16B (I) 30.05 28.6 28.88
    TR-18B (I) 33.33 31.8 32.00
    TR-20B (I) 36.60 34.9 35.15
    TR-22B (I) 39.86 38.1 37.58
    TR-24B (I) 43.12 41.3 40.65

     

    Application Areas

    Applications include downhole tools, aerospace systems, process equipment, ordnance, marine hardware, medical devices, and sporting goods.
